Abstract:
The potential for radio communications to be used in asymmetric operations against coalition forces has grown exponentially and has expanded well beyond the now-familiar IED detonators. Expeditionary forces, in particular, convoys on the move, need an effective counter surveillance capability to combat this threat. Following a very successful Phase I effort, the team of 21st Century Systems Incorporated (21CSI) and Missouri University of Science and Technology is pleased to propose to continue our research and development of a counter surveillance concept called TRANSURV. This transmission surveillance tool is the synergistic pairing of RF DF equipment and video cameras to provide persistent perimeter surveillance without incurring a large manpower footprint. The RF sensors are used to cue video cameras (slew-to-cue), which slew to the RF source. Utilizing advanced video analytics, TRANSURV analyzes the scene for human presence and alerts the operator. Built on 21CSIs successful force protection product line, TRANSURV provides decision support that enhances situational awareness and security.
